The first thing to consider is your residency status. In Texas? Great news, you qualify for in-state tuition! Out-of-state? Don't worry, SFA is still a great value. Here's a quick breakdown:
- In-state tuition: This is the lower rate for students who are residents of Texas. For undergraduates, expect to pay around $10,600 USD per year.
- Out-of-state tuition: This applies to students who are not residents of Texas. Out-of-state students pay a higher tuition rate, around $21,616 USD per year.

Tuition isn't the only thing to consider when budgeting for college. Here are some other costs to keep in mind:
- Room and board: On-campus housing and dining plans will vary in cost, but you can expect to pay around $9,642 USD per year.
- Books and supplies: Factor in around $1,202 USD per year for textbooks and other school supplies.
- Other expenses: Don't forget about extras like transportation, clothing, entertainment, and that occasional pizza delivery. Budget around $3,674 USD per year for these miscellaneous expenses.
The Bottom Line: How Much Does it REALLY Cost?
Adding it all up, the total cost of attendance at SFA can vary depending on your residency status, lifestyle choices, and whether you live on or off campus. But to give you a general idea, here's a ballpark range:

- In-state students: Expect to pay somewhere between $25,118 USD and $30,000 USD per year.
- Out-of-state students: The total cost could range from $36,230 USD to $41,000 USD per year.

How to Save Some Serious Green
Here are some tips to help you minimize the financial burden of college:

- Apply for scholarships and grants: There are tons of scholarships and grants available to help offset the cost of college. Don't be afraid to apply for everything you qualify for!
- Consider living off-campus: On-campus housing can be convenient, but it's not always the most affordable option. Explore the possibility of living in an apartment or renting a house with roommates.
- Cook your own meals: Eating out all the time can add up quickly. Learn to cook some basic meals to save money on food costs.
- Buy used textbooks: Textbooks can be expensive, so consider buying used books whenever possible. There are also online resources where you can rent or borrow textbooks.
